Abstract
Neutron absorption correction coefficients have been calculated numeri cally for annular cylindrical samples which are highly absorbing mater ials (1 < mu R < 30). The angular variation of the absorption factor d iffers from that of an equivalent full cylinder. As an example, a gain of a factor of 15 in diffracted intensity can be reached at low Bragg angles for mu R = 18 if an annular cylinder is used instead of a full cylindrical sample holder with the same amount of material.
